Dolphins Activate Odell Beckham Jr. From PUP List
                
        
        The Miami Dolphins are activating wide receiver Odell  Beckham  Jr. (knee) from the Physically Unable to Perform list on Saturday, and he will make his 2024 debut in Week 5 on Sunday against the division-rival New England Patriots. Beckham practiced in full all week, his first week back after having a procedure on his knee in the offseason. "On a team that is very motivated to win a football game, I think he's eager to try to help do that," head coach Mike McDaniel said. The 31-year-old was listed as questionable on Friday's final injury report. OBJ's return gives Miami more depth behind Tyreek  Hill and Jaylen  Waddle, but Beckham won't be a realistic starting fantasy option, at least until/if quarterback Tua  Tagovailoa (concussion) is able to return later this year. For now, Beckham will compete for targets with the likes of Braxton  Berrios and rookie Malik  Washington.
